About the Medical Center: Adventist Health Ukiah Valley (AHUV) is part of the North Coast Network of Adventist Health, which includes two acute care facilities, three critical access medical centers and a center for behavioral health. AHUV is a faith- based, not- for- profit health and wellbeing organization located in the county seat of Mendocino County, operated as a 49- bed hospital with 735 associates, 167 medical staff members and 18 affiliated clinics offering both specialty and primary care services to Mendocino County and surrounding Lake County communities. Our new emergency department operates with a physician on duty 24- hours a day and is designated as a level IV trauma center. Medical Services include Emergency Services, Family Birth Center, Inpatient Medical Care, Intensive Care Unit, Lab Services, Medical Imaging, Outpatient Laboratory, Outpatient Rehabilitation, Pharmacy, and Surgical Services. Medical Offices include Behavioral Health, Cardiology, Cancer Care, Family Medicine, Gastroenterology, General Surgery, Internal Medicine, Orthopedics, Ophthalmology, Pain Management, Pediatrics, Pulmonology, Rheumatology, Sports Medicine, Urology, Women's Health (OB/GYN), and Wound Care. Community Overview: Nestled in the Ukiah Valley, Ukiah is a mid-sized town surrounded by vineyards, pear orchards and redwood-covered hills. Ukiah's strong sense of community is clearly present in its numerous town celebrations, festivals and events, including the Ukiah Country PumpkinFest, which celebrates Ukiah's rich agricultural tradition each October. All sorts of recreational opportunities can be found at Lake Mendocino, just five miles from Ukiah, with over 100 family picnic sites, boat launching ramps, fishing, a swimming beach, hiking trails and much more. For entertainment, Ukiah boasts a number of theatrical companies. The Grace Hudson Museum makes for another entertaining diversion, featuring exhibitions of the works of artist Grace Hudson as well as local, regional and California Native American artists. Ukiah is located about two hours north of San Francisco and one hour from the Pacific Coast and redwood forests.

Adventist Health Rideout is seeking an experienced Cardiothoracic PA to join our thriving program in beautiful Northern CA just outside of Sacramento. Office-based pre-op H&P and post-op recovery of both Cardiovascular and Thoracic surgery patients including, OR and CVICU. The position is very autonomous and performing at a high level of acuity and responsibility. OR assisting for both Cardiovascular and Thoracic surgery cases including Endoscopic Vein Harvesting using the MAquet VasoView Hemepro 2 system. Performance of bedside procedures including thoracentesis, chest tube placement, arterial lines and central venous access Daily duties to be split 50/50 with current PA. Working as a team the candidate will alternate daily between the OR and non-surgical duties. Currently 2 surgeons and 1 PA doing 100+ hearts a year plus about the same number of thoracic cases annually. We're looking for someone to join our team as a Physician Assistant (Outpatient) who: Evaluates, diagnoses and provides patient care, treatment and services, including the performance of physical exams, diagnosing conditions, development of treatment plans, health counseling and prescribing medications for patients seen by the collaborating/supervising physician in an outpatient setting. Assumes total care of patients under the direction of a physician. Follows established standards, procedures and practices, and gives specific patient modalities to health clinic staff. Regularly demonstrates subject matter expertise regarding medication, treatment, and patient care standards. Wage Scale: $139,004 to $208,505. Apply to learn more about our total compensation and benefits! Total compensation may vary based on additional services, including call coverage, administrative services, performance bonus, etc. Compensation may also vary based on productivity after initial guarantee period. Essential Functions: Evaluates and treats patients within prescribes parameters. Orders appropriate tests, treatments and counsels, as needed. Performs complete, detailed and accurate patient histories. Reviews patient records to develop comprehensive medical status reports. Orders laboratory, radiological and diagnostic studies appropriate for complaint, age, race, sex and physical condition of the patient. Completes physical examinations and records pertinent data in acceptable medical forms. Makes medical diagnoses and institutes therapy or patient referrals to the appropriate health care facilities, agencies, resources of the community, or other physicians. Obtains and interprets patient data to determine appropriate diagnostic and therapeutic procedures, as needed. Develops and implements action plan for practice changes to enhance patient outcomes. Arranges hospital admissions and discharges at the direction of the Supervising Physician. Performs hospital rounds and records appropriate patient progress notes. Transcribes and executes specific orders at the direction of the Supervising Physician. Compiles detailed narrative and case summaries. Utilizes specific knowledge and skills in a surgical environment to assist the surgeon. Works under minimal supervision. Completes forms pertinent to patients' medical records and issues diagnostic orders, which must be signed within specified time period as defined by hospital guidelines. Interprets and evaluates patient data to determine patient management and treatment. Mentors, develops, inspires, educates and leads staff members in patient care setting. Enhances efficiency and cost effectiveness by identifying opportunities to decrease costs, as applicable to the job. Provides instructions and guidance regarding medical care matters to patients. Performs or assists with routine medical techniques and procedures. Performs other job-related duties as assigned.
